Episode narrativeepisode_narrativeThe Blue 2 wildfire continued into June, but improving weather conditions slowed its growth considerably compared to it's initial activity at the end of May. Evacuations were lifted by June 3rd as crews gained 59 percent containment and activity within the burn area dwindled. Some growth was observed on June 5th with the burned area reaching 7,532 acres, but containment grew to 87 percent.
Event narrativeevent_narrativeGrowth of this wildfire slowed considerably at the start of June with the total burned area growing nearly 80 more acres to 7,532. Evacuations were lifted by June 3rd.
